The sculpted shape fits naturally into your hand, offering a choice of a 0- or 20-degree tilt angle to align with your natural arm posture, significantly reducing muscle fatigue by up to 20% compared to a traditional mouse.

Not just a marvel of physical design, the MX Ergo Plus also boasts advanced functionality. It allows seamless switching between speed and precision tracking modes, perfect for those moments when you need pinpoint accuracy or swift navigation. With its Flow-enabled technology, you can effortlessly juggle tasks across two computers, streamlining your workflow like never before. Key Features:

  • Wireless trackball mouse for enhanced workflow
  • Thumb control for instant switching between speed and precision modes
  • Adjustable 0° or 20° angle for comfortable wrist and forearm positioning
  • Flow-enabled functionality for seamless multi-computer use
  • 8 customizable buttons for maximum control
  • Rechargeable battery lasting up to 4 months
  • Compatible with Windows and Mac systems

Product specs

Type Wireless Trackball Mouse
Compatibility Windows 10/11, macOS 10.15 or later, ChromeOS, Linux
Computer Connectivity Bluetooth, USB Reciever (included)
Power Source Built-in Li-Po Battery, 500mAh
Dimensions 5.22" x 3.93" x 2.02"

Owner Insights

We analyzed real musician discussions from forums and Reddit to find what players love, question, and tweak about Logitech MX Ergo Plus Wireless Trackball.

Features and functionality

  • The MX Ergo Plus includes a rubber wedge for additional tilt, allowing closer to vertical hand positioning for improved ergonomics.

    Source
  • The MX Ergo S supports connection to only two devices, unlike some competitors that offer connections to three devices.

    Source
  • The MX Ergo is exclusively a trackball and cannot operate like a traditional mouse, requiring users to switch devices for certain activities like gaming.

    Source

User experience

  • Owners with smaller hands find the MX Ergo Plus slightly large but still comfortable, though wrist pain can occur with extended use.

    Source

Build quality

  • Some users experience recurring scroll wheel issues similar to those found in earlier M570 models.

    Source
  • Some users describe the scroll wheel and ball as feeling "woodier" and slightly louder, potentially due to differences in casing materials.

    Source
  • Users report rapid wear on left click-buttons due to inferior internal switches, necessitating potential replacements for durability.

    Source

Comparisons

  • The M575 is larger than the M570 but smaller than the MX Ergo, offering a middle ground in size.

    Source

Mods and upgrades

  • A Perixx ball replacement for the M575 can significantly improve trackball smoothness.

    Source
  • Owners have successfully converted older MX Ergo models to USB-C and replaced switches with Omron 20m, noting quieter operation post-modification.

    Source
  • Some owners replace original switches with higher-quality versions to resolve rapid wear issues and improve longevity.

    Source

Value and pricing

  • There's no advantage to purchasing the MX Ergo Plus directly from Logitech; alternative retailers may offer better deals.

    Source

Setup and maintenance

  • Users recommend "breaking in" the trackball with heavy rolling to reduce initial stiction and improve smoothness.

    Source

Use cases and applications

  • Some users report that the hand positioning on the MX Ergo S can lead to soreness, especially when used at an angle, possibly due to the slipperiness of the new surface material.

    Source
  • Initial thumb strain is common with first-time trackball users, but many find it alleviates wrist pain over prolonged use.

    Source

Software and compatibility

  • Bluetooth pairing and essential functions work in OpenSUSE Linux, suggesting similar performance in Fedora due to shared kernel support.

    Source
